Background
Along with the gradual development of various mechanical devices towards light weight and high speed and heavy load, the harm caused by vibration is more and more obvious, so that the reduction of the harm of the vibration has very important significance. Wire rope isolators are one of many devices for reducing vibration. The steel wire rope vibration isolator is arranged between the vibration source and the equipment, so that the influence of vibration on the equipment can be effectively weakened, the vibration born by the machine and the instrument is controlled, and the vibration strength is limited within an allowable range. The steel wire rope vibration isolator has the advantages of strong environmental adaptability, long service life, various mounting modes, strong buffering and impact resistance, large damping, convenience in mounting and the like. The vibration isolation buffering of electronic and mechanical equipment and instruments such as airborne equipment, vehicle-mounted equipment, ship-borne equipment and the like.
However, the existing steel wire rope vibration isolator is easy to generate large deformation under stress, so that the stability is insufficient, the vibration reduction effect is reduced, the existing requirements are not met, and the steel wire rope vibration isolator with the rubber body for multi-directional limiting is provided.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-6, the present invention provides an embodiment: a steel wire rope vibration isolator with a rubber body for multi-directional limiting comprises a positioning piece 1, a vibration reduction steel rope 2 and a rubber limiting piece 3, wherein the vibration reduction steel rope 2 is arranged to be of a spiral structure, two positioning pieces 1 are arranged, the two positioning pieces 1 are respectively positioned outside the upper end and the lower end of the damping steel rope 2, the rubber limiting piece 3 is arranged on the inner side of the damping steel rope 2, the limiting strips 31 are respectively arranged on one side of the front end and the other side of the rear end of the rubber limiting piece 3, the limiting strips 31 and the rubber limiting piece 3 are of an integral structure and are integrally formed, the integrity is good, and spacing 31 is provided with threely, is provided with spacing groove 32 between the adjacent spacing 31, and damping steel cable 2 passes spacing groove 32, and the both sides of spacing groove 32 outer end all are provided with spacing bead 33, and spacing bead 33 and spacing 31 structure as an organic whole, and logical groove 34 has been seted up to the inside of rubber locating part 3, and fixed slot 35 has been seted up to the bottom of rubber locating part 3.
Further, the through groove 34 is internally provided with the supporting spring 4, the supporting spring 4 is fixedly connected with the rubber limiting part 3, the number of the supporting springs 4 is three, and the three supporting springs 4 are sequentially arranged, so that good damping and buffering effects can be achieved by utilizing the good elasticity and the deformation recovery capacity of the supporting springs 4.
Further, the positioning member 1 includes a lower plate 11 and an upper plate 12, a lower positioning groove 111 has been seted up to the one end of the lower plate 11 close to the upper plate 12, a lower fixing hole 112 has been seted up to the inside of the lower plate 11, a connecting groove 113 has been seted up to the upper end of the lower fixing hole 112, an upper positioning groove 121 has been seted up to the one end of the upper plate 12 close to the lower plate 11, an upper fixing hole 122 has been seted up to the inside of the upper plate 12, the outside of the bottom end of the upper fixing hole 122 is provided with a positioning seat 123, and the positioning seat 123 and the upper plate 12 are of an integral structure.
Further, lower constant head tank 111 and last constant head tank 121 all are provided with a plurality of, and adjacent lower constant head tank 111 and last constant head tank 121 constitute a circumference, conform with damping steel cable 2's appearance, are convenient for fix damping steel cable 2, and lower fixed orifices 112 and last fixed orifices 122 pass through bolted connection, and the connected mode is simple, the operation of being convenient for.
Further, the positioning seat 123 is set up to round platform shape structure, and the positioning seat 123 extends to the inside of spread groove 113 to agree with the spread groove 113 and be connected, round platform shape structure makes the diameter variation at positioning seat 123 both ends, and then can align fast when the assembly, improves assembly efficiency.
Further, antiskid groove 36 has been seted up in the fixed slot 35 outside, and antiskid groove 36 is provided with a plurality of, when reducing rubber locating part 3 and using the material, can play good antiskid effect.
The working principle is as follows: when the vibration-damping steel rope is used, the vibration-damping steel rope 2 is wound into a spiral shape, and the two positioning pieces 1 are respectively arranged outside the upper end and the lower end of the vibration-damping steel rope 2. Each circle of the damping steel rope 2 sequentially passes through the lower positioning grooves 111 of the lower clamping plate 11, then the upper clamping plate 12 is installed above the lower clamping plate 11, the damping steel rope 2 is attached, the other part of the damping steel rope 2 is fixed in the upper positioning groove 121, the positioning seat 123 of the upper clamping plate 12 is sequentially inserted into the connecting groove 113 of the lower clamping plate 11, the upper clamping plate 12 and the lower clamping plate 11 are preliminarily connected, and finally the lower fixing hole 112 and the upper fixing hole 122 are connected through bolts, so that the lower clamping plate 11 and the upper clamping plate 12 are assembled. The rubber locating part 3 sets up in the inboard of damping steel cable 2, and the fixed slot 35 block of 2 bottoms of damping steel cable is in the outside of the setting element 1 that is located 2 lower extremes of damping steel cable, and every circle damping steel cable 2 blocks in each spacing groove 32 of rubber locating part 3 in proper order, and spacing 31 that spacing groove 32 outer end both sides set up can block damping steel cable 2, avoids damping steel cable 2 to drop from spacing groove 32. Damping steel cable 2 atress earlier plays the damping effect, when the pressure that receives is great, 2 deformation aggravations of damping steel cable, and rubber locating part 3 atress thereupon utilizes the damping characteristic of rubber self to play good shock attenuation effect, and 3 logical groove 34 internally mounted's of rubber locating part supporting spring 4 uses with it cooperatees simultaneously, plays good shock attenuation effect, can effectively improve the damping effect of wire rope isolator. The rubber limiting part 3 can effectively prevent the vibration reduction steel rope 2 from generating larger torsion and deformation in the working process, thereby improving the vibration reduction stability of the steel wire rope vibration isolator.
